About Minneapolis, MN
As a Travel Infusion Nurse in Minneapolis, MN here's what you should know:- The cost of living in Minneapolis is slightly higher than the national average, particularly in housing and transportation.
- However, wages generally match up with the higher cost of living, especially in healthcare and nursing.
- Average summer highs in Minneapolis range from 80-85°F, while winter lows can drop to 5-10°F.
- Winters are cold and snowy, while summers are warm and humid.
- Short term rentals and furnished housing options are available in Minneapolis, and they can be found with relative ease, especially in popular neighborhoods and near healthcare facilities.
- Minneapolis is car-friendly, with well-maintained roads and highways.
- Public transportation is also available through buses and light rail, providing convenient options for getting around the city.
- Minneapolis is a diverse city with a wide range of ethnicities and ages.
- Common health issues include seasonal allergies, asthma, and obesity.
- There is a large population of travel nurses in Minneapolis, making it a welcoming community for healthcare professionals.
- Minneapolis offers a vibrant dining scene with a variety of cuisines, a rich cultural scene with theaters and art museums, a thriving music scene, and plenty of outdoor activities including parks, biking trails, and skiing in the winter at nearby areas like Hyland Hills Ski Area.
